#903825 Hex color

#903825

The hexadecimal color code #903825 corresponds to the code RGB( 144, 56, 37 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,56 level), green (at 0,22 level) and blue (at 0,15 level). Its brightness is 35% and its saturation is 59%. It is composed of red at 60%, green at 23% and blue at 15%.
